20th CES repairs sidewalk

The 20th Civil Engineer Squadron pavement and construction shop started a sidewalk demolition and replacement project here, Sept. 3, on the eastside of Building 1118, more commonly known as the 20th Force Support Squadron building.

There are no delays as of now; patrons are able to still enter into the building through alternate routes. The only section that is blocked is the stairs and crosswalk located on the eastside of the building.

The reconstruction is being led by Tech. Sgt. David Mitchell, 20th CES project manager.

"The reason for this current project is to avoid tripping hazards for patrons and employees entering the facility," said Mitchell. "Over time tree roots in the area caused the concrete pavement to become uneven."

The project is scheduled to be completed by Sept. 20, if inclement weather does not delay progress.
